I recently figured out how to equalize/compress the audio on my system using LADSPA plugins with ALSA. They're pretty cool and extremely useful for me. What I'm wondering now is if there's something similar for X. I want to be able to adjust the actual values of the pixels drawn to implement things like brightness and contrast control as well as more complex things (like scaling to use the full range of brightness). I know about '/proc/acpi/video/VGA/LCD/brightness' but I think you would need something that is done strictly in software. I tried searching for software like this but had trouble finding anything.
